The Cleveland Town Planning and Zoning Commission has scheduled a meeting for Sept. 3, 2026, at 7:00 p.m. according to a September 2 statement. The meeting will be held at 130 West Main in Cleveland.
The agenda for the meeting includes the approval or denial of several home-based business licenses. Specifically, the commission will discuss applications from Deana Murray, Dillon Hickok for a jewelry making business, Christy Hickok for work as an online influencer, and Mrs. Galloway for a photography business.
Prior to the action items, the meeting will include a call to order, a pledge, and the approval of July meeting minutes. A period for public comments has been set aside for individuals to express concerns or questions not listed on the agenda, with a three-minute limit per person.
The next regular Planning Commission Meeting is scheduled for Oct. 1, 2026, at 7:00 p.m. at the Cleveland Town Office located at 130 W. Main, Cleveland.
